This week's Stampin'Bs challenge was to use Flower Soft, Liquid Applique, or Glitter. My choice was Flower Soft. In addition, the Ways to Use It challenge was to make a Sweet Treat. What better sweet treat than a slice of birthday cake! I used Flower Soft Ultrafine Raspberry Fizz on the icing and DCWV Sweet Stack DP.
